Transaction 74d621540130c8b768e2ccc15a408e2b83c6257848dd6404410771f1777698df

1 Input
2 Outputs
  • 74d621540130c8b768e2ccc15a408e2b83c6257848dd6404410771f1777698df:0
  • value  2255000
    address  3AzJzh8T7QKhgYXK6d36ecepkRVX32jPXx
  • 74d621540130c8b768e2ccc15a408e2b83c6257848dd6404410771f1777698df:1
  • value  1351492540
    address  3CeMQscv3bzZ4U4Wmqrrw3cVLc4eHWfC12